Santa Clara (home)
- Santa Clara enter Saturday’s game in poor form, having failed to win any of their last five games.
- They have lost two straight after a 0-1 home loss to Famalicao and a 1-0 defeat at Moreirense.
- The island-based club sit 14th in the Primeira Liga 2025/2026 with 17 points from 19 games.
Estoril Praia (away)
- Estoril Praia are on a hot streak, winning four of their last five matches.
- Estoril have taken 26 points from 19 matches to sit 8th in the league.
- Ian Cathro’s tactical tweaks since his July 2024 appointment have produced a more proactive, high-pressing side.

Head-to-Head
- There have been no draws in the last five meetings between these sides in all competitions.
- Santa Clara have won three of those encounters and Estoril two.
- The most recent clash finished 1-0 in Santa Clara’s favour four months ago.
- When Santa Clara host Estoril, matches have averaged 4.5 goals combined, with Santa Clara averaging 2.5 and Estoril 2.0.
Estoril Praia
- Yanis Begraoui has found the net 13 times in 19 Primeira Liga matches.
- He has struck seven goals in the club’s most recent five matches.
Santa Clara
- Vasco Matos’ side typically set up with an organised low-block and look to create chances on the break.
- They can overload wide areas and are solid in transition but are rarely prolific in the attacking third.
